Noah's Mom 02-03-2006, 05:32 PM I picked up these two, hoping to try them on Noah, but I have a few questions. I ate a few rice chex, and they seem a bit hard and they don't dissolve quickly. Will he choke on these? Also, is there any reason Noah can't have Cream of Wheat?
sixdogssixcats 02-03-2006, 06:28 PM Catherine loves both of those. She's been eating rice chex for several months now. They're much more fragile than cheerios, which I just recently started letting her have. Cream of Wheat, if you get the flavored instant packets and mix it with formula instead of water, is a good high-calorie meal. Catherine will eat up to half a packet mixed according to package directions. It does take forever to cool, though, so make it ahead of time.
Janette 02-03-2006, 06:44 PM You could try hot water or hot milk/formula on the chex. It'll help them to dissolve more quickly. Maybe even break them up a bit before adding the liquid.
